cell
Nouns
-
(n) any small compartment
- the cells of a honeycomb
- (n) (biology) the basic structural and functional unit of all organisms; they may exist as independent units of life (as in monads) or may form colonies or tissues as in higher plants and animals
- (n) a device that delivers an electric current as the result of a chemical reaction electric cell,
- (n) a small unit serving as part of or as the nucleus of a larger political movement cadre,
- (n) a hand-held mobile radiotelephone for use in an area divided into small sections, each with its own short-range transmitter/receiver cellphone, cellular phone, cellular telephone, mobile phone,
- (n) small room in which a monk or nun lives cubicle,
- (n) a room where a prisoner is kept jail cell, prison cell,
